| Core Tip |
Gastric adenomas exhibit subtype-specific characteristics; intestinal adenomas linked to family history of gastric adenocarcinoma and atrophic gastritis, foveolar adenomas associated with n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drug use and intestinal metaplasia, and pyloric adenomas presenting as large multiple polyps. Understanding the unique clinicopathological features of different subtypes of gastric adenomas helps to implement risk-stratified surveillance strategies and address modifiable factors like Helicobacter pylori infection to reduce recurrence rates. |
